2000 A6 Avant 2.8--Opinions Needed Please
Hello to all. New to the site. A little background on me. I worked for Audi among other brands as a service writer and service manager in the early 90's and have owned a 4000s and a 98' A4 1.8t manual (which worked well).
My question at this time is what weak points or common problems are that I should look for on a 2000 A6 Avant 2.8? It hat 112k, orig. owner, minor wear and tear, needs tires, has had t-belt done recently, older couple own it, asking $6500 (which sounds high), no modifications.
Some other sights I have run across have given me some concern about possible transmission problems occurring. Can anyone tell me if this is a valid concern, and if so how to check it or prevent it?
My closest Audi dealer is at least five hours away. I try and perform most of my own repairs and get quite a few parts over the internet.
Any knowledge or opinions would be appreciated. Thanks from NW Montana

I have 2000 Avant with 185k. No issues with tranny. My issues are: (1) small leak in gas tank's nipples at the top of the tank(normall stuff, but very expesive to fix), I'm living with it. (2) The alternator is sporadically acting up, it's time to replace it I guess, will get to it with next timing belt replacement, which I will do shortly. (3) I had to replace driver's side catalytic converter, not because it was clogged but because it split open at the flex connector, again costly part and labor. Other than everything you touch is very expensive I'm very happy with this one and will get another one once I drive this one to the ground.
